Ross McNaughton, strategic services general manager at National Australia Bank, is being questioned over NAB allowing a Queensland grazier's debt to balloon to A$7.8 million from A$3.3 million by imposing punitive default payments over several years of drought and crashing prices.
Recorded on 29 June 2018 at the Brisbane Magistrates Court.

Testimony held during the fourth round of public hearings on issues affecting Australians who live in remote and regional communities at the Australian Royal Commission into Misconduct in the Banking, Superannuation and Financial Services Industry.
